Calling anyone a bust at this point in their rookie season would be premature. But I think there are a few things working against Lonzo:

1) Rookies typically struggle with the complexities for NBA defence but most rookies have been asked to PLAY defence throughout high school and college. Lonzo has never needed to do anything other than freelance for steals. He is miles behind where he should be defensively.

2) His shooting action makes it impossible for him to shoot the ball moving to his right. That scout - left J, right drive - might be harder for college kids to play to, and fewer of them will have the length and quickness to execute it effectively against a player of Ball's caliber. But there aren't many NBA teams that don't have at least a couple of guys who can cause him all sorts of problems because of it.

3) His passivity dramatically reduces his efficiency because he doesn't get to the FT line. He doesn't put opposing back courts under any real pressure. His passing can put a team defence under pressure, but individually he's not that much of a threat.

His passing vision is ridiculous but I don't think he's going to be a quick fix because there are so many critical areas of the game where he needs to improve. I think offensively, Rubio is a reasonable comparison, but Rubio is an elite defender. I certainly don't think he's showing enough at this point that Lebron would be comfortable going to LA just to play with Lonzo.

Whilst it is very early to call him a bust, unfortunately some of the limitations in his game are so ingrained and so significant that I don't see them ever been grown out of.

In short; I think some of the things that he can't do are not because he hasn't learned to do/adjusted to doing them at NBA level yet; but simply because he can't do them and probably won't ever be able to do them (i.e. mid-range pull-ups; contested 3's, shooting off right hand dribble etc.).

I think the shooting issues aside; his defence is also terrible.

He will meet his expectations as a ball-distributor; but with his lack of shooting/scoring and sub-par defence, the question is can you afford having a guy like that on the floor who can ultimately really hurt you in major areas of the game.
